You can find more information in <br />your final program and in the conference app, Whova, to receive these <br />points. <br /> <br />For those pursuing CMC (Certified Municipal Clerk) or MMC (Master <br />Municipal Clerk) certification, this conference provides 1 CMC Education <br />or 1 MMC Advanced Education point for every 4 hours of approved <br />participation in combination with a completed learning assessment. St. <br />Cloud State University will provide a Certificate for those participants who <br />check “YES” during the registration process. The cost is covered by <br />MCFOA. Please be sure to request them at the time of registration for <br />costs to be covered. If IIMC Points will not play a role in your ongoing <br />education plans, then you need not obtain them. <br /> <br />Continuing Education Units/Customized Certificates <br />For those who are not tracking Education Points, but desire a certificate <br />for CEUs (Continuing Education Units) or Certificate of Attendance, you <br />may request if it meets the criteria you need. A CEU is defined as, “10 <br />contact hours of participation in an organized continuing education <br />experience under responsible sponsorship, capable direction, and <br />qualified instruction.” If you want a customized certificate, the cost is $15 <br />each.
